This 560 is owned by an experienced yachtsman who has proudly owned her since buying her pre-owned three years ago.
Starting from the transom in this beautiful and professionally maintained 560 Sedan Bridge and moving forward,. She is equipped with a hydraulic swim platform with mounts for the Wave runner, which is included in the sale of the vessel. Transom storage, the 50 amp shore power cord is deployed through this storage compartment.
In the cockpit you'll find a transom door and cockpit seat with padded backrest and more access to the transom storage compartment. Ample under gunnel storage on both port and starboard sides. Moving forward to the bridge access steps you'll find additional storage and access to the 560's generator and fuel manifolds selector switches. The Compartment step access hatch is supported by a hydraulic ram for ease of access to the respective controls. Stainless handrails on port and starboard sides lead to the bridge. Centerline on the cockpit is the engine room and lazarette hatch access. To port molded steps provide easy access for boarding and departing from the 560.
Entering the salon from the sliding stainless steel frame and glass door you'll find port and starboard facing sofas. The starboard sofa also features a full size "hide-a-bed" feature to allows additional over-night guest comfortable bedding that is very easy to access.
Forward of the salon is the galley with Sub-Zero under counter refrigerator and freezer. Icemaker, above fwd counter the microwave is enclosed in the cabinet. Clean and uncluttered surfaces. 3 burner stove with the matching counter top counter is located in front of and below the microwave. Stainless steel sink (with a cover) is just to the left of the stove.
Dinette is elevated and opposite of the galley can accommodate 4 comfortably. Extra storage beneath each of the seats.
Proceeding forward and down the steps to the staterooms you find the Guest stateroom to starboard. She boasts a queen size berth, TV, hanging locker, dresser storage cabinets and a mirror. Private access to the guest staterooms head. To port is a smaller 3rd stateroom with over-under bunks, a small cabinet for clothes, TV and a locker above the lower washer/dryer cabinet. The washer/dryer is housed In a cabinet in the forward portion of the stateroom.
Moving forward in to the master stateroom you'll find a very large center-line berth. Large TV, tons of storage in cabinets on either side of the berth a spacious cedar lined hanging lockers. Nice make-up table with mirror, storage locker behind the mirror. The port side spacious cedar lined hanging locker. Just aft of the hanging locker is the private master head, only accessible from the stateroom. Stand-up shower, vanity with sink with cabinet and ample storage.
Moving to the air conditioned bridge, access is via molded integral fiberglass steps with stainless handrails on both sides of the steps. Reefer and ice maker in the fwd wet bar, located to stb forward of the helm. Full eisenglass enclosure with "U" #10 zippers, black Sunbrella canvas will significantly, if not totally prevent mold from growing on the enclosure. Crescent shaped seating for 5 (comfortably) forward of the bridge allows for the captain in interact easily with his/her guests, Fiberglass table greet for entertaining or just relaxing either cruising or docked. Ergonomically designed instrument cluster is easily accessed making for cruising and navigating safely.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2004 Sea Ray 560 Sedan Bridge is a popular luxury motor yacht known for its spacious design and comfortable cruising capabilities.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Spacious Interior: The 560 Sedan Bridge offers a large, open interior layout with multiple living areas, including a salon, full galley, and multiple staterooms, making it ideal for extended trips and entertaining guests.
Flybridge with Hardtop: The spacious flybridge features a hardtop and plenty of seating, providing excellent visibility and a comfortable outdoor space for navigation and relaxation.
Performance: Powered by twin diesel engines, the boat delivers reliable performance with a smooth ride and good cruising speeds suitable for coastal and offshore trips.
Quality Build: Sea Ray is known for solid construction and attention to detail, and the 560 Sedan Bridge benefits from quality materials and finishes throughout.
Ample Storage: Generous storage compartments and cabinetry help keep the living spaces organized and clutter-free.
Modern Amenities: Equipped with a full galley, entertainment systems, air conditioning, and other comforts, it offers a luxurious onboard experience.
Cons
Fuel Consumption: Due to its size and twin diesel engines, fuel consumption can be relatively high, making it less economical for long-range cruising.
Draft: The boat’s draft may limit access to shallow waters and some smaller marinas or anchorages.
Maintenance Costs: Like many large yachts, maintenance and upkeep can be costly and time-consuming, especially as the boat ages.
Maneuverability: Its size can make docking and tight maneuvering more challenging for less experienced operators.
Older Electronics: Depending on upgrades, the original 2004 electronics and navigation systems may be outdated, potentially requiring investment in modern equipment.
